Settlers Federal Credit Union is a community-chartered credit union that was established in 1932 by a small group of local farmers. Today, it provides a range of financial services to its members, including checking and savings accounts, loans, credit cards, and more. With a commitment to the credit union philosophy of "People Helping People, " Settlers Federal Credit Union aims to serve its members and the communities it serves. The credit union has grown significantly over the years, with assets now exceeding $750,000. In April 2008, it moved into a new main office building and continues to focus on providing exceptional service to its members. The credit union is federally-insured by the National Credit Union Administration and is regulated by the Fair Housing Law and Equal Opportunity Credit Act.
